Understanding Small Deep Well Pumps


A small deep well pump is designed specifically to extract water from deep underground sources, typically from wells that are more than 25 feet deep. These pumps come in various sizes and capacities, making them suitable for a wide range of applications, from residential water supply to small agricultural irrigation systems. They are usually submersible, meaning they are placed underwater in the well, allowing them to function effectively even at significant depths.


Most small deep well pumps operate using electricity or solar power, making them versatile for different locations, including remote or off-grid areas. They can typically pump between a few gallons per minute to several hundred, depending on the model and the depth of the water source.


Key Features of Small Deep Well Pumps


1. Efficiency Most small deep well pumps are designed for energy efficiency, minimizing operational costs while maximizing water output. Advances in technology have led to the development of high-efficiency motors and impellers that improve performance.


2. Durability Constructed from rugged materials such as stainless steel and reinforced plastic, these pumps are built to withstand harsh conditions and prevent corrosion. Their durability ensures a longer lifespan and reduced maintenance costs.


3. Compact Design The compact nature of small deep well pumps makes them ideal for installation in tight spaces. This design also allows for easy handling and installation, often requiring less manpower and equipment.


4. Automatic Controls Many modern small deep well pumps come equipped with automatic controls and sensors. These features help manage water levels, preventing dry running and ensuring optimal functioning without constant manual oversight.

Benefits of Using Small Deep Well Pumps


1. Reliable Water Supply Small deep well pumps provide a consistent and reliable source of water, essential for both irrigation in agriculture and daily use in households. By accessing underground aquifers, they can supply water even in areas where surface water is scarce.


2. Cost-Effective The initial investment in a small deep well pump can lead to significant savings over time. With lower electricity consumption compared to traditional pumps and minimal maintenance requirements, they offer an economical solution for water extraction.


3. Environmentally Friendly Solar-powered deep well pumps, in particular, present an eco-friendly alternative to conventional electricity-dependent pumps. They reduce reliance on fossil fuels and minimize carbon footprints, making them a sustainable choice for many communities.


4. Enhanced Crop Yield For farmers, a stable water supply is crucial for irrigation, which directly affects crop yields. Small deep well pumps enable farmers in arid regions to cultivate crops year-round, improving food security and local economies.


Applications


Small deep well pumps have a diverse range of applications. In agriculture, they are used for irrigation of crops, livestock watering, and general farm activities. In residential settings, they provide water for drinking, cooking, and sanitation. Additionally, these pumps are commonly employed in construction, mining, and other industries that require reliable water for various processes.
